1903 is a very common date Indian Head cent. For an accurate assessment of value the coin needs to be seen and graded. Most coins of this type have seen heavy use and show a lot of wear. In general retail values for low grade coins are $1.00-$2.00, better grade are $3.00-$9.00 and coins showing almost no wear run from $20.00-$24.00. Values are a market average and only for coins in collectible condition, coins that are bent, corroded or have been cleaned have far less value if any to a collector or dealer

Please post a new question with the coin's date. If it's 1908 or 1909, also see if there's a small "S" in the bow of the wreath on the back.

Without the date and mint mark it's not possible to give even a ballpark value, because Indian Head cents were struck from 1859 to 1909 and have values ranging from maybe a dollar for the most common ones up to many tens of thousands for the rarest ones.

The U.S. never made cents out of silver. For one thing, a large cent made of silver would have been worth more than a half dollar at the time. Your coin has almost certainly been plated for use in jewelry or something similar, which unfortunately has destroyed what would have been a fairly significant collectible coin. Values for undamaged 1803 cents range anywhere from $60 for the most common specimens in very worn condition, up to several thousand dollars for the rarest varieties.
